首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

捕获select中的值,并通过jq在顶层对象中使用它

在前端开发中,可以通过jQuery(简称jq)来捕获select中的值,并在顶层对象中使用它。具体步骤如下:

  1. 首先,确保在HTML页面中引入了jQuery库文件。可以通过以下方式引入:
代码语言:txt
复制
<script src="https://cdn.jsdelivr.net/npm/jquery"></script>
  1. 在HTML中定义一个select元素,并给它一个唯一的id,以便后续通过id来获取该元素的值。例如:
代码语言:txt
复制
<select id="mySelect">
  <option value="value1">选项1</option>
  <option value="value2">选项2</option>
  <option value="value3">选项3</option>
</select>
  1. 在JavaScript代码中,使用jQuery的选择器来获取select元素的值,并将其存储在一个变量中。例如:
代码语言:txt
复制
var selectedValue = $('#mySelect').val();

这里使用了jQuery的选择器$('#mySelect')来选中id为"mySelect"的元素,并使用.val()方法获取其值。

  1. 接下来,可以将获取到的值应用到顶层对象中。顶层对象可以是全局对象,例如window对象,或者是自定义的对象。例如,将获取到的值赋给顶层对象的一个属性:
代码语言:txt
复制
window.selectedValue = selectedValue;

或者:

代码语言:txt
复制
myObject.selectedValue = selectedValue;

这样,就可以在后续的代码中通过window.selectedValuemyObject.selectedValue来使用这个值。

总结: 通过以上步骤,可以捕获select中的值,并通过jQuery在顶层对象中使用它。这样可以方便地在前端开发中获取用户选择的值,并进行后续的处理。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JSON神器之jq使用指南指北

如果您使用 运行 jq --argjson foo 123,则 $foo程序可用具有123。...通过加入更大字符串来添加字符串。 通过合并添加对象,即将两个对象所有键值对插入到单个组合对象。如果两个对象都包含相同键,则右侧对象+获胜。(对于递归合并,请使用*运算符。)...如果它未命名) 捕获不匹配任何内容组会返回 -1 偏移量 capture(val),capture(regex; flags) JSON 对象收集命名捕获,每个捕获名称作为键,匹配字符串作为对应...高级功能 变量大多数编程语言中是绝对必要,但它们 jq 中被归为“高级特性”。 大多数语言中,变量是传递数据唯一方式。如果你计算一个,并且你想多次使用它,你需要将它存储一个变量。...它在右侧采用一个过滤器,.通过该表达式运行旧来计算分配给属性

28.4K30
  • 使用 Shell Operator + CRD 恢复被暂停 Argo Workflow

    上一篇讲到,使用 Kyverno 通过对特定标签识别,让每个步骤进入自动暂停状态,实现逐步骤运行。留了个尾巴,怎样才能快速恢复被暂停步骤运行?...这篇文章会使用这一框架,从 CR 资源获取用户恢复运行指定步骤意图,完成恢复运行操作。...Dockerfile: 继承 Flant Shell Operator,用来构建运行镜像。 Kubernetes YML: 用来 Kubernetes 运行 Shell Operator。...脚本 符合触发条件 CR 一旦创建,就会被 Shell Operator 捕获保存到对应 Pod 文件系统,临时文件名保存在环境变量 BINDING_CONTEXT_PATH 里。...调试 Shell Operator 工作过程难免会出现问题,我主要依赖三板斧: 使用 kubectl logs 查看 Pod 日志。

    10210

    学习jQuery?这篇文章就够了

    1.1、标签中使用on事件属性 1.2、通过JS给标签设置 on 事件属性 1.3、通过JS调用方法方式 2、jQuery 事件绑定 3、练习 十、jQuery 常用 DOM 操作方法 1、append...2、引入 jQuery 新建 webapp/jq_01/01.jQuery_hello.html,文件引入 jQuery <!...】5月7日16时18分,浙江宁波 一男性乘客因不愿按规定缴纳车费,辱骂强行拉拽驾驶员胳膊,致使正常行使公交车失控,穿过中间绿 化带与对向行驶公交车相撞。...$() 找不到元素不一样: 通过 jQuery 方法获取页面元素,都是 jQuery 对象。...说明:这个标签是直接选择 HTML 代码 class=”myClass” 元素或元素组(因为同一 HTML 页面 class 是可以存在多个同样元素)。

    12.3K10

    jQuery源码研究:化繁为简之拎出框架结构

    而jQuery真正主体部分是工厂函数,在里面实现了所有功能,下面我将工厂函数函数体按行标记分割成许多小模块,分割依据是按照功能块不同,下面列出我分割好jQuery简化框架: 1(function...8 function( w ) { //如不支持,就通过本行匿名函数抛出错误,返回jQ工厂函数,但功能是否都支持,就鬼知道了......= null && obj === obj.window; 4} 解释:window对象是浏览器全局变量,该对象有一个属性window,通过window === window.window可以判断参数全等于...应用: 1$.isWindow(window); //true 2$.isWindow(this); //true 3// 浏览器环境顶层作用域中时this指向window,nodejs环境顶层作用域中全局变量是...,则 1jQuery.fn.init.prototype === jQuery.fn // true 所以jQuery原型链上绑定了很多方法,同时 1jQuery.fn === jQuery.fn.init.prototype

    71520

    记录一下Jquery日常使用过程一些经验

    $(selector).is(selectorElement,function(index,element)) jqcss基础上扩展了很多选择器,尝试使用你会有很多意外惊喜。...jq很多操作都是异步,代码顺序不代表操作执行顺序。要求严格的话,需要通过指定操作时间来控制执行顺序。...jq.index(),获取指定jq对象jq对象集合里索引位置。 Mutation Observer API 用来监视 DOM 变动。...js对象方法被调用是this仍然指向是调用时所在对象,而不是对象自身。调用自身方法可使用对象引用。 jq不支持事件捕获。需要使用捕获模式只能用js。...通过addEventListen原生方法处理。冒泡是从内到外,捕获是从外到内触发事件。 onscroll是滚动条滚动,onwheel是鼠标滚轮滚动事件。

    1.1K20

    Web前端基础(06)

    ###JavaScript对象分类 内置对象: number/string/boolean等 浏览器相关对象BOM: Browser Object Model浏览器对象模型 页面相关对象DOM: Document...元素对象.name/id/value 原生JavaScriptDOM相关内容jQuery框架基本实现了全覆盖,所以只需要掌握jQuery框架使用方式即可 ###jQuery框架...js对象jq对象互相转换:(js对象jq对象不是一个东西,不能互相调用彼此方法,有些时候只能js对象但是需要用到jq框架里面的方法这时候就需要使用以下方式将js对象转成jq,同理有时只能得到jq...对象但是需要调用js对象里面的方法,所以需要使用以下方法把jq对象转成js对象) //js获取对象方式 var js = document.getElementById(“d1”); //jq获取对象方式...对象 var jq = $(js); //jq.val() 获取文本框 alert(jq.val()); }); $("#b2").click(function(

    2.7K20

    「Clickhouse Array 力量」1-2

    特定虚拟机有我们想要测量不同属性(如SSD存储特定),以及因操作虚拟机团队而不同标签(如应用程序类型)。...jq 将记录从JSON数组剥离出来,并将每个记录放在一个单行上,以符合 ClickHouse JSONEachRow 输入格式: cat vm_data.json |jq -c .[] | clickhouse-client...这是一个通用表表达式或CTE例子。 CTEs通过从主查询移除常量表达式来帮助降低查询复杂性,是ClickHouse最佳实践。我们将在其他例子中使用它们来保持事情可读性。...ClickHouse数组函数是相当多样,涵盖了广泛使用情况。下面是如何寻找 "group"标签为 "rtb" 虚拟机名称。正如你可能猜到,indexOf()函数返回一个索引。...我们可以用它来引用另一个数组,这允许我们tags_name和tags_value数组之间建立数值关系。

    2.2K00

    SQLServerCTE通用表表达式

    本期专栏,我将给出示例解释它们使用方法和适用情况。我还将演示 CTE 是如何处理递归逻辑定义递归 CTE 运行方式。...每次紧随其后查询引用 CTE 底层查询时都会调用它。 因此,同样情形也能用 CTE 来编写,如图 3 所示。...EmpOrdersCTE 收集聚合数据,然后紧随 CTE 之后查询中使用该数据。使用 CTE 之后,图 3 代码令查询变得非常易读(就像视图一样),而且并没有创建系统对象来存储元数据。...MAXRECURSION 层可以含有 CTE 批处理通过服务器端设置(服务器范围设置默认为 100,除非您更改它)显式设置。这个设置限制了 CTE 可递归调用其本身次数。...图 5 EmpCTE 显示了收集销售副总裁员工记录定位点成员 (EmployeeID = 2)。定位点成员查询最后一列返回 0 ,这表示分层顺序第 0 层,也就是最顶层

    3.8K10

    关于使用jq 处理json格式简单笔记

    上述命令 括号里面可以带有参数,这个参数就是 数组下标,这个下标从前向后最小是 0,最大没有限制,如果超出,那么就会return null. 同时支持下标从后向前基数,最小为-1....如果要获得对象所有元素key,那么要把 |keys 串接在对象后面,需要注意是 这里不是利用shell管道,而是jq内置管道,所以属于jq参数一部分....".[0]|keys" #获取所有的key,如果value 依然是对象,那么这里不会列出value对象key...| jq '.[0]|has("user")' true [root@localhost Desktop]# 4). jq 查找结果避免输出 错误,转而输出null 查找条件后面加上一个问号,...这个问号可以加在方法后面(后面的例子可以看到)。

    6.7K10

    CKAD考试实操指南(六)---剖析系统:深入可观察性实践

    通过CKAD-exercises提供练习题,你可以知十平台云原生环境中进行实践和模拟。在这个过程,你将熟悉Kubernetes各种操作和场景,并在实践中加深对知识理解。...- **Exec 探针:** 容器内运行指定命令,如果命令成功执行返回零退出代码,容器被认为是健康。...# 选择 JSON 对象 "name" 属性 echo '{"name": "John", "age": 30}' | jq '.name' # 选择 JSON 数组第一个元素 echo '...# 选择数组中大于 2 元素 echo '[1, 2, 3, 4]' | jq 'map(select(. > 2))' - **对象属性访问:** 使用 `.key` 来访问 JSON 对象属性...# 获取 JSON 对象 "age" 属性 echo '{"name": "Alice", "age": 25}' | jq '.age' - **数组索引:** 使用 `[index]` 访问数组特定索引处

    39500

    从 MySQL 到 ClickHouse 实时数据同步 —— Debezium + Kafka 表引擎

    MySQL 数据库更改通过 Debezium 捕获,并作为事件发布在到 Kafka 上。ClickHouse 通过 Kafka 表引擎按部分顺序应用这些更改,实时保持最终一致性。...此外,执行删除操作情况下(Clickhouse 同样无法解析),它会创建 tombstone 记录,即具有 Null 记录。下表展示了这个行为。...本示例,MySQL test.t1 表以 id 列为主键,如果更新了 remark 列, ClikHouse ,最终会得到重复记录,这意味着 id 相同,但 remark 不同!...之后 ClickHouse 集群任一实例上,都能从物化视图中查询到一致 MySQL 存量数据。...因此,需要定义一个主表,通过物化视图将每个 Kafka 表记录具化到它: -- 注意时间戳处理 CREATE MATERIALIZED VIEW db2.consumer_t1 on cluster

    1.2K10

    React事件初探

    本文初探react顶层事件代理机制~ 顶级事件代理机制 React采用顶层事件代理机制,能够保持事件冒泡一致性,可以跨浏览器执行,甚至可以IE8中使用HTML5事件。...我们能通过简单字符串操作来获取所有父级 component 父级内容,再把事件监听存储hashmap当中。下面的例子展示了事件广播到整个virtual DOM时传播流程。...,我们可以从这个事件对象获取到事件引用,但是这些事件对象也意味着高额内存分配。...为了减轻垃圾回收负担,React 启动时就为那些对象分配了一个内存池,当我们需要用到某一个事件对象时就可以从这个内存池进行复用。 React事件系统框图 * +------------+...React实现了一套完整事件合成机制,能够保持事件冒泡一致性,同时可以实现跨浏览器执行,甚至可以IE8中使用HTML5事件。

    79410

    React学习(二)-深入浅出JSX

    React通过读取这些对象,然后使用它们来构建 DOM 以及保持随时更新 注意: React并没有模板语言(类似Vuetemplate),但是它具有JavaScript全部功能 可以JS书写...具体使用 JSX嵌入表达式{ 表达式 } 双大括号内可以是变量,字符串,数组,函数调用, 但是不可以是对象,也不支持 if,for语句 例如:你表达式里写对象:它是会报错 { {name:...如果您要渲染子集合,请使用数组 当然如果是数组的话,它会自动给拼接起来,本质上是通过数组join("")方法处理后结果 { ["川川", "全宇宙最帅"]} //川川全宇宙最帅 当然对于JSX...()与JQ$("")创建一个js对象jQ对象,而在React,React就是一个实例化对象,更深层次探讨的话,React也是基于原型对象构建出来 尽管React与前两者不同,但是笔者仍然觉得有类似...以及JSX一些注意事项,JSX具体使用,嵌入表达式,最重要是JSX原理,使用JSX,react是如何将jsx语法糖装换为真实DOM,渲染到页面,当然,JSX仍然还有一些注意事项,边边角角知识

    2K30

    Mybatis 手撸专栏|第14章:解析和使用ResultMap映射参数配置

    本章,我们将深入探讨ResultMap概念、使用方法以及相关配置和技巧。通过本章学习,相信您能对ResultMap有更深入理解,并能够灵活地运用它来处理复杂查询结果。1....这样,查询结果时,Mybatis会自动将user_id列赋给User对象id属性。...ResultMap使用使用ResultMap进行查询结果映射时,我们可以映射配置通过标签来引用ResultMap,指定查询语句。...在上述示例,我们将ResultMap配置放在标签顶层通过id属性定义了ResultMap唯一标识符。...本章,我们详细介绍了ResultMap概念、使用方法,以及常见配置示例和技巧。通过本章学习,您应该对ResultMap有了更深入理解,并能够灵活地运用它来处理复杂查询结果。

    48930

    React事件初探

    本文初探react顶层事件代理机制~ 顶级事件代理机制 React采用顶层事件代理机制,能够保持事件冒泡一致性,可以跨浏览器执行,甚至可以IE8中使用HTML5事件。...首先区分原生事件与合成事件,我们 componentDidMount 方法里面通过 addEventListener 绑定事件就是浏览器原生事件,使用原生事件时候注意在 componentWillUnmount...我们能通过简单字符串操作来获取所有父级 component 父级内容,再把事件监听存储hashmap当中。下面的例子展示了事件广播到整个virtual DOM时传播流程。...为了减轻垃圾回收负担,React 启动时就为那些对象分配了一个内存池,当我们需要用到某一个事件对象时就可以从这个内存池进行复用。 React事件系统框图 * +------------+...React实现了一套完整事件合成机制,能够保持事件冒泡一致性,同时可以实现跨浏览器执行,甚至可以IE8中使用HTML5事件。

    1.1K80

    React 事件初探

    本文初探react顶层事件代理机制~ 顶级事件代理机制 React采用顶层事件代理机制,能够保持事件冒泡一致性,可以跨浏览器执行,甚至可以IE8中使用HTML5事件。...首先区分原生事件与合成事件,我们 componentDidMount 方法里面通过 addEventListener 绑定事件就是浏览器原生事件,使用原生事件时候注意在 componentWillUnmount...我们能通过简单字符串操作来获取所有父级 component 父级内容,再把事件监听存储hashmap当中。下面的例子展示了事件广播到整个virtual DOM时传播流程。...为了减轻垃圾回收负担,React 启动时就为那些对象分配了一个内存池,当我们需要用到某一个事件对象时就可以从这个内存池进行复用。...React实现了一套完整事件合成机制,能够保持事件冒泡一致性,同时可以实现跨浏览器执行,甚至可以IE8中使用HTML5事件。

    1.7K00
    领券